How they compare

Suriname currently reports 4,407 m3 against 4,103 m3 in Sudan (former), a difference of 304 m3.

That makes Suriname's figure about 1.1 times Sudan (former)'s.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 5 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Sudan (former) ahead.

Sudan (former) ranks 72nd and Suriname ranks 71st of 151 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, Sudan (former) averaged higher in 1 and Suriname in 1.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
